#bbf0e0 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#bbf0e0 is composed of 73.3% red, 94.1% green and 87.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 22.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 6.7% yellow and 5.9% black. It has a hue angle of 161.9 degrees, a saturation of 63.9% and a lightness of 83.7%. #bbf0e0 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#77e1c1. Closest websafe color is: #ccffcc.

#bbf0e0 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#bbf0e0 has RGB values of R:187, G:240, B:224 and CMYK values of C:0.22, M:0, Y:0.07, K:0.06. Its decimal value is 12316896.
